Top-Down vs. Bottom-Up Processing
The traditional manifestation advice relies entirely on top-down processing: using the brain to force the body into compliance. "Think positive thoughts, and eventually, you'll feel better." For people who are deeply burnt out, this approach spectacularly fails. The brain simply doesn't have the leverage to force a traumatized body to relax.
The shift happens when we pivot to bottom-up processing. This means we bypass the noisy, exhausted mind entirely and go straight to the body. We regulate the physiology first. We lower the heart rate. We release the fascia. We deepen the breath. When the body finally feels safe, it sends a bottom-up signal to the brain saying, "The threat is gone." Only then do your thoughts naturally align with abundance—without you having to force them into submission.
How To Expand Your Somatic Capacity To Receive
So, how do we stop trying to hack our mindset and start regulating our biology? The key is expanding your physical capacity to hold the reality you desire. You can only receive what your nervous system feels safe enough to tolerate.
First, we practice titration. This is a clinical term for introducing change in small, digestible micro-doses. Stop trying to quantum-leap from deep poverty to massive wealth in one intense meditation. To a dysregulated body, a quantum leap is a massive threat. Instead, give your body tiny tastes of your desire. If you are manifesting wealth, don't buy a car you can't afford. Buy the premium brand of coffee, sit with it, and deliberately track the physical sensation of having something luxurious. Notice the warmth in the mug. Notice the taste. If your chest tightens, breathe into it until it softens. You are teaching your body that having nice things is physically survivable.
Second, prioritize vagal toning. Your vagus nerve is the information superhighway between your brain and your body. When you stimulate the vagus nerve, you send an immediate biological cue of safety to your organs. You can do this without any spiritual jargon. Deep, slow diaphragmatic breathing, humming, cold exposure on your face, and even gently rocking your body all tone the vagus nerve.
